Light blue flowers. Compact, rounded mounds of Blue Chips look charming in a rock garden, front of border or as an edger. Low carpets of attractive leaves topped with upward facing flowers, from June thru October. Has no equal as an edging plant.

General Information:
Campanula are versatile perennials that provide a wide range of colors, shapes and uses. Many varieties offer long bloom time and easy care, while others feature some of the best blues and deepest purples in the perennial world. Spikes, globes, carpets-all valuable in any garden. Carpatica prefer moist, well-drained soil. Does well in either sun or part shade. May stay evergreen in the south.
Plant Care:
Remove about a third of the plant after blooming to freshen the foliage. Can be divided every 3-4 years in spring or fall.
